Remnants of Order: The Election Labyrinth

Yuuji Asakura never planned to be in the spotlight. He’s fine coasting where nobody notices him. Yet somehow, after a vote gone wrong, he’s on the ballot for the Harmori High Student Council president. Each vote could change everything. How did he even get here?

It starts on a humid day in May. The class rep blurts out nominations. Yuuji is busy working on his sketchbook. Suddenly, the room looks at him while ink spills over his math notes.

— “Yuuji, you’ll do it, right?” grins Natsumi Handa, never letting a friend idle. He tries to brush her off, mumbling that there are better choices. Most laugh. Not the vice-principal, who now assumes Yuuji will run.

Two days of rumors race down the halls. Being president sounds like an uphill job. Meetings, class forums, club budgeting. Yes, Harmori’s had some wild elections – one year, a pet rabbit almost won on a technicality.

“If anyone can sort this right, maybe it’s you,” calls Haruki Saito, a quiet but serious first-year who stalks nearby as Yuuji grabs bread from the vending machine.

In his head, Yuuji debates why he was picked out—He’s not flashy, never a top scorer. Does that sound like any president you know? Or maybe that’s the point.

By next morning, Yuuji faces the councilroom gates. Natsumi ropes him into a meeting with the current Student President, Nanami Suzuhara. She’s strict yet wishes, just once, for things to go smooth. “Don’t think too much. If you believe in fixing what we’ve got, people will follow.”

What’s the worst that could happen? Well, an anonymous mail spreads across groups, trashing all the candidates. Rival parties surface overnight: the Literature Club’s thinkers, Track’s ‘discipline-first’ pack, Colorful Club leaders with wild ideas like vending-machine grants for every club.

Yuuji skips lunch, stunned. In comes Renji, his former-deskmate and classic joker. Renji slides into the sunlit windowsill: “Run with me. We’ll change this place, one prank, one idea at a time. Don’t say no now.”

You ever feel the weight of a small choice blowing up in your face? Is luck real, or do we all make our own fate? If you could lead, would you shrug or would you step up?

Reports of the smearing messages start growing. Vice President Mei Tanaka brings leaks showing official correspondence is at risk of hacking. The tension doubles, especially once rumors sprout claiming school staff could meddle in the final count.

Natsumi, upbeat but sharp, begs for unity. “Maybe confidence isn’t about being right but showing up?” So the odd crew — an artist, a nerd, a jokester — piece together their program in Mr. Takeuchi’s empty history classroom weekly.

Numbers start changing. On Tuesday, leading by two points. Friday, plunging beneath the Basketball Club by seven. It’s never stable. Meanwhile, baked goods vanished from the staff room, making everyone edgy if you want to know about side dramas.

Clubs swarm them for campaign debates. Old Recital Hall, four in the afternoon.
The panel moderator barely keeps up. One leader throws shade. “You can’t even manage your own time—what makes you think you’ll handle ours?” Yuuji glances down, ink thread running on his hand (from doodling). He nearly walks—but then stares straight at the audience:

“Maybe the thing we’re weak in is being too alone. But that’s why we’re up here now. Even if we mess up, let’s agree to care for the school for real. No masks. No excuses.”

Packed seats stay silent, then dim giggles spark a chain outburst. Will words be enough? Real doubt swims with him, but something does shift. Confidence or just nerves, he can’t tell.

Are school elections a farce — or do they show who’s really ready to take charge? Did you ever doubt your ability until the test arrived unplanned?

Last day to sway the votes, and news drops: Mei and Renji hack out a path to reveal who’s behind the smear campaign. All trails lead to an unthinkable source—the vice-principal, desperate for her own chosen candidate to win.

Natsumi types furiously, prepping evidence while Renji produces a log for the school-wide forum. Naked truth by sunset.

But it’s not so closed. Just as Yuuji walks up to the school entrance, above them unfolds a strange projection on the wall, someone else’s manifesto video hijacking the day: “It’s time a student council mattered. You’ll never silence us. We run things from the club floor to the gates; pick wisely—”

Without a word, Yuuji grips his sketchpad. Across from him, every rival, friend, or onlooker turns, ready for whatever happens at tomorrow’s election—even as the school moderators scramble to pull down the video feed and find who’s now playing puppet master to every group in the school.

What choice means most—cheating or action, quiet protest or tough truth—if you had the keys for one week only, would you risk shaking it up for everyone? The real count comes next. Doors crack, students lean in…the day after can’t come soon enough.
